We go into the service bay area where Rod’s bike is on the bench and being attended to by master mechanic for Honda, Bob Lemon. No operating theatre could be more pristine and well organized and we trust we are in excellent hands and leave with lighter hearts.
Late Saturday afternoon we double up on ‘Paladin’ (Okay – I let Rod drive) and head into the historic area of Kingman where they are having the annual street drags. Cars, motorcycles, pocket bikes, 4 wheel ATV’s and trucks all souped up to the nines and LOUD … VERY LOUD !!! With everything from Nitro burning monsters to the everyday daily driver. From professional race cars to junior dragsters, there is something for everyone.
